Output 6c0b58d001b8faede041b26e188cb8ccac0827a32eee1b366483f88714ed9636:25

value
26416360
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3d5ec6a6b01a3f548f759b863f79c9deb062cd68b16c6ccdd6632f9627934507
address
tb1p840vdf4srgl4frm4nwrr77wfm6cx9ntgk9kxenwkvvhevfung5rsvzd4pz
transaction
6c0b58d001b8faede041b26e188cb8ccac0827a32eee1b366483f88714ed9636
confirmations
11028
spent
true